6. What does ISICT offer?
Free housing, if
not resident in
Genoa
Undergraduate and graduate students of the ICT Programs
are selected by a competition, on the basis of merit, only.
To the first Students in the
pass-list ISICT offers:
All the ISICT Students receive free
admission to the educational program of
ISICT
Scholarship for
development of thesis
abroad

8. ISICT Enrichment Program
Contribute to the preparation of qualified personnel:
- for research and academic teaching;
- high-profile professionals and executives
Teaching in two fields:
- companies’ organization, finance,
and economics,
- technical-scientific subjects.
Seminars by international experts
and study periods abroad.
